This visit I got it in my mind to try something different other than my normal Double Double. I ordered a "3X3" animal style extra grilled onions and put the lettuce and tomato on the side. I never had a 3x3 before and wanted to see it it was that much better than a regular Double Double. It was only like $1.70 I think more. One other guy on my crew did the same. I asked for the lettuce and tomato on the side, cause I thought the additional height of this 3x3 might be too much for my mouth to open. Our orders come out and wow, that 3x3 sure has a lot of melted cheese all flowing out of it! I hate when the cheese isn't melted! OK, Here goes my 3x3, I open wide and ease that meaty goodness into my mouth. Biting down, it is a different experience than a regular Double Double. More meat centric with out the lettuce and tomato. The buns were toasted well and there was a crunch from that. I did like the 3x3, but I think the Double Double is a more balanced burger experience. That familiar taste of the Double Double wasn't there, more just meat and cheese, but yeah lots of meat. I'm glad I thought to give this 3X3 a try animal style, but I think next time I'll stick to the Double Double animal style with my extra grilled onions. This bug meat burger was enough for lunch so I skipped the fries. A 4 X 4 is the biggest option In N Out will make, but that way too much meat to fit in my mouth!

    This is a one person does it all and her name is Susy! She'll greet you, take your order and make…read moreyour food, also chat with you. Feels like stepping in your auntie's place. You can tell she loves her job and is proud of her cook. This place may not look fancy like other Italian restaurants with dim lighting, fancy deco, but her food speaks for itself. Her salad is always fresh and flavorful. We had avocado salad. It's not just a bed of mix green with avocado slices. There's apple slices, mixed green, every piece is lightly covered with rich and refreshing dressing. The pizza is not the usual pizza from pizzeria, she made it from scratch. It has its own texture. Pork lasagna is light! It is not the typical thick pasta layers. Everything is made from scratch. We love it. My friend said it's more northern Italian cooking. It's not loaded with red tomato sauce. The pasta is thinner, the ground pork is tender. Then comes my favorite short rib ravioli. I'm usually not a fan of ravioli, because they're always full of cheese and nothing else, but Susy's is full of short rib. Just meat, not trying to cheat with cheese or cream. If I want real authentic Italian food, I'll come here. I love how Susy will stop by the table, chat with us, told us what tv show she's watching. When she's excited, she'll talk with her hands, what an adorable lady. One thing to keep in mind, it's a one person's does it all, so it'll take a bit longer to get your food. Come in hungry but not too hungry so you don't get hangry!
